Web28 dec. 2024 · Always remove the bark. It will come off eventually anyway. Route the edges (even the live edge) with a round over bit to break the edge. WebStep 3: Cleaning Up the Edge. Most live edge material comes with bark on the edges. While this can look really nice, it is prone to falling off after going through a few seasons in your house due to the changes in humidity. I suggest pulling out your trusty chisel and removing it before it comes off on it's own.
